Handover note — Mira to Tomas. Contractor Dele Okafor finished week one on the Larkspur refit without issues. Timesheets are approved through Friday; his toolbox stays in cage B overnight. He still needs escorting into the plant room until his induction clears. For now he can use the shared badge code below.

badge for fawef-hagug: bdg-YJL-1

Subject: Quickstore 4.2 — bloom filter now fronts the KV layer

Plugin authors: starting with this release, Quickstore places a bloom filter ahead of the key-value store. Negative lookups return faster; false positives fall through safely. No API changes are required on your side. Verify your plugin against the staging build referenced below.

session token of fahif-tadup = htk3_9c7

## Cold starts — Lanternfall handlers

Handlers in the Lanternfall ingest tier cold-start in 3–6 s due to driver init. Provisioned concurrency covers the top three routes only. If a change touches module-level imports, check init time in the bench job before approving. Lazy-load anything over 50 ms. Current runtime configuration for the handler pool is below.

settings of tagef-bawif:
DRUIX_HOST=druix.zemvarlabs.internal
DRUIX_PORT=8000

## Deploying the Tallygram Sidecar

Welcome aboard! The Tallygram sidecar rides alongside each app pod and batches metrics before shipping them upstream. Deploys are boring on purpose: push the manifest, wait for the rollout, check the dashboard. Don't tweak flush intervals without asking Priya first — it bites. The defaults we run everywhere are shown below.

service settings:
PRAWYN_PIN=9848
PRAWYN_METRICS_HOST=metrics.prawyn.lumicworks.corp
PRAWYN_LOG_LEVEL=warn
PRAWYN_TENANT=pelius